A leading consultancy in Milton Keynes is seeking a Geo-Environmental Engineer to join their growing team. The ideal candidate will have experience in geotechnical or geo-environmental consultancy and possess a degree in a relevant field.

The role offers a competitive salary between £28,000 and £34,000, alongside benefits including private medical cover and opportunities for professional development.

If you are passionate about contaminated land and eager to make an impact on diverse projects, consider applying for this permanent role.
